1000 piece puzzles are custom made in Australia and hand-finished on 100% recycled 1.6mm thick laminated puzzle boards. There is a level of repetition in jigsaw shapes with each matching piece away from its pair. The completed puzzle measures 76x50cm and is delivered packaged in an attractive presentation box specially designed to fit most mail slots with a unique magnetic lid

Jigsaw Puzzles are an ideal gift for any occasion

Estimated Product Size is 50.2cm x 76cm (19.8" x 29.9")

These are individually made so all sizes are approximate

EDITORS COMMENTS
This woodcut print titled "Poseidon / Neptune" takes us back to the ancient world of Rome and Greece, where deities ruled over land and sea. The intricate details in this artwork bring forth the majestic presence of Poseidon, known as Neptune in Roman mythology. As the god of the sea, he holds a prominent position among other gods and goddesses. The artist skillfully captures Poseidon's commanding figure with his muscular physique and flowing beard. His piercing eyes reflect both power and wisdom, while his regal crown signifies his divine status. In one hand, he firmly grasps his iconic trident, symbolizing control over the vast waters beneath him. Surrounded by fish swimming gracefully around him, Poseidon stands as a guardian of marine life. These creatures represent not only his domain but also serve as a reminder of his ability to create storms or calm turbulent seas at will. This woodcut print transports us into an era steeped in Greco-Roman mythology—a time when people believed that gods walked among them. It serves as a testament to humanity's fascination with these ancient tales that continue to captivate our imagination today. Whether displayed in homes or art galleries, this remarkable piece invites viewers to delve into the rich history and timeless allure of Greek and Roman culture through its masterful craftsmanship.
